Flyers recall Brandon Manning from Lehigh Valley

The Philadelphia Flyers recalled defenseman Brandon Manning shortly after Saturday's loss to the Boston Bruins.

His summoning is believed to be in response to Michael Del Zotto having suffered a right foot injury in the game, per various reports

Del Zotto played to the final whistle, but was hobbled after a blocked shot in the first period. 

Manning has 10 goals and 42 points in 54 games with Lehigh Valley, and contributed an assist in three games with the big club.
